config/companion_libs/ppl.in
author Anthony Foiani <anthony.foiani@gmail.com>
Thu May 19 23:05:58 2011 +0200 (2011-05-19)
changeset 2460 132c00ad3d6e
parent 2338 006e955b2343
child 2484 d1a8c2ae7946
permissions -rw-r--r--
complibs/ppl: remove unnecessary (and confusing) --enable-cxx configure switch.

PPL does not use the "--enable-cxx" configure switch at all; it's
possibly a cut-and-paste leftover from 'gmp.sh'. (PPL is written in C++
natively, so it doesn't make much sense to have to enable C++; GMP, on
the other hand, is written in C with an optional C++ wrapper.)

Signed-Off-By: Anthony Foiani <anthony.foiani@gmail.com>
     1 # PPL options
     2 
     3 choice
     4     bool
     5     prompt "PPL version"
     6 # Don't remove next line
     7 # CT_INSERT_VERSION_BELOW
     8 
     9 config PPL_V_0_11_2
    10     bool
    11     prompt "0.11.2 (EXPERIMENTAL)"
    12     depends on EXPERIMENTAL
    13     select PPL_0_11
    14 
    15 config PPL_V_0_11_1
    16     bool
    17     prompt "0.11.1 (EXPERIMENTAL)"
    18     depends on EXPERIMENTAL
    19     select PPL_0_11
    20 
    21 config PPL_V_0_11
    22     bool
    23     prompt "0.11 (EXPERIMENTAL)"
    24     depends on EXPERIMENTAL
    25     select PPL_0_11
    26 
    27 config PPL_V_0_10_2
    28     bool
    29     prompt "0.10.2"
    30 
    31 endchoice
    32 
    33 config PPL_VERSION
    34     string
    35 # Don't remove next line
    36 # CT_INSERT_VERSION_STRING_BELOW
    37     default "0.11.2" if PPL_V_0_11_2
    38     default "0.11.1" if PPL_V_0_11_1
    39     default "0.11" if PPL_V_0_11
    40     default "0.10.2" if PPL_V_0_10_2
    41 
    42 # For PPL 0.11, we need to pull libpwl if configured static
    43 config PPL_0_11
    44     bool
    45     default n
    46     select PPL_NEEDS_LIBPWL if ! COMPLIBS_SHARED
    47 
    48 config PPL_NEEDS_LIBPWL
    49     bool
    50     default n